Introduction: Dento-alveolar trauma to the maxillary incisors
often requires combined clinical and radiographical follow-up.
The number of radiographs can add up substantially in particular
cases, which subsequently results in a higher patient’s absorbed
radiation dose. As a consequence from the X-ray beam’s downward
angulation, the thyroid gland potentially receives a substantial
amount of radiation, both from the primary beam as from the
scattered radiation.
Aim: Assess the absorbed radiation dose by the patient’s
thyroid gland by means of Personal Computer X-ray Monte Carlo
calculations (PCXMC® 2.0 software), taking into account voltage,
milli-Ampères, exposure time, vertical projection angle, beam
collimation and age of the patient.
Results: The use of a longer focus-to-skin distance and a
rectangular collimator resulted in a significant lower radiation dose
to the thyroid gland. The latter was irrespective of the patient’s age.
The dose to the thyroid gland was significantly higher in younger
subjects. The impact of the vertical projection angle was not similar
for all age categories Conclusion: The dose to the thyroid gland seems to be mostly
affected by the size of radiated surface, the focus-to-skin distance
and the milli-Ampère exposure time product. The study assessed
only the absorbed radiation dose by the thyroid gland under different
radiographic exposures, mimicking real clinical circumstances and
did not did not assess image quality. Therefore the results should be
interpreted with care.
Keywords: Dento-alveolar trauma; Radiographs; PCXMC®;
Children; Thyroid glands radiation.
